How We Evaluated Real-World Enterprise Software Development Delivery

Firms were scored on a 100-point rubric across five factors:

  • Proven Enterprise Delivery (30 points): Documented case studies with Fortune 1000 or regulated-industry clients showing measurable outcomes.
  • Senior Engineering Depth (25 points): Average years of experience, consultant tenure at the firm, and senior-to-junior mix on delivery teams.
  • Onshore Delivery Model (20 points): U.S.-based team composition, embedded delivery structure, and time-zone alignment with client stakeholders.
  • Technology Breadth (15 points): Coverage across Java, .NET, JavaScript, and modern cloud platforms (AWS, Azure, GCP) without a prescribed stack.
  • AI-Accelerated Delivery (10 points): Evidence of AI or agentic tools integrated into the software development lifecycle.

The dataset aggregates published case studies, third-party reviews (Clutch, G2, Gartner Peer Insights), public financial and headcount data, documented technology stacks, and independently verified client relationships.1

Thoughtworks is a Chicago-headquartered global technology consultancy with roughly 12,300 employees across 18 countries.9 Founded in 1993, the firm built its reputation on agile software delivery and has published influential works on continuous delivery, microservices, and the Technology Radar. Its current positioning centers on enterprise modernization, AI-era software delivery, and the 3-3-3 Delivery Model that targets moving from idea to production in 90 days.10

Thoughtworks’ client base spans Fortune 500, public sector, and social-sector organizations across automotive, financial services, retail, healthcare, media, and manufacturing. The firm’s scale and global distribution make it a credible choice for multi-region transformation programs. Clients who specifically require strictly U.S.-based senior teams should confirm delivery composition during contracting, as the global model means team makeup varies by engagement.

Object Computing, Inc. is a Creve Coeur, Missouri consulting firm founded in 1993, with deep roots in enterprise Java and open-source software.11 The firm stewards two notable open-source projects, OpenDDS and Micronaut, and its consultants contribute regularly to the broader Java and distributed-systems communities.

Object Computing’s delivery model centers on senior Java and distributed-systems engineers working on enterprise modernization and long-running custom software programs. Its positioning remains rigorously software-engineering-led, with emphasis on open-source stewardship and long-tenured senior engineers. For Java-heavy modernization programs that benefit from deep framework expertise and multi-year delivery continuity, Object Computing is a credible specialist choice.

EPAM Systems is a Newtown, Pennsylvania global digital engineering firm founded in 1993, with approximately 62,850 employees across more than 55 countries.14 The firm is publicly traded (NYSE: EPAM) and has built its reputation on enterprise digital transformation, cloud modernization, and software product engineering at Fortune 500 scale.

EPAM’s services span digital engineering, cloud, AI/ML, cybersecurity, product design, robotic process automation, and managed IT. Its client base includes energy, cybersecurity, and fintech Fortune 500 firms. EPAM’s delivery is globally distributed; buyers whose primary criterion is strictly U.S.-based senior engineers should confirm delivery composition and senior-to-junior ratios during scoping.

Core Decision Dimension: Onshore Senior Delivery vs. Global Scale

A primary distinction among custom enterprise software firms is whether they operate with a 100% U.S.-based senior delivery model or a global/blended delivery model.

Model Characteristics Best Fit
Onshore Senior Delivery 100% U.S.-based senior consultants; embedded team structure; architect-level engagement; low turnover Organizations requiring senior engineering judgment, regulated-industry compliance, or delivery continuity across multi-year programs
Global/Blended Delivery Large bench capacity across multiple countries; variable seniority mix; cost leverage through offshore or nearshore teams Organizations prioritizing scale, multi-region coverage, or cost optimization over onshore team composition

Neither model is inherently better. The right partner depends on whether your organization prioritizes senior engineering depth and onshore continuity or large-bench capacity and cost optimization.
